Wet-bulb globe temperature (WBGT) is the heat measure that actually tracks danger to the body. Unlike the plain air temperature on your phone, it folds in humidity, wind, and direct sun: the factors that decide whether your sweat can still cool you. It’s the standard the military, athletic associations, and occupational-safety bodies use to call when outdoor activity is no longer safe.

Does Texas have a heat policy for school sports?
UIL (University Interscholastic League) publishes UIL 2026-27 Heat Stress & Athletic Participation Required Plan, which uses wet-bulb globe temperature. Texas’s activity zones appear beside the live reading in the app. Our WBGT is a modeled estimate rather than the on-site device reading a policy may call for, so check the association's own document for current requirements.

Why is WBGT more useful than the temperature for Killeen?
Air temperature ignores humidity, wind, and sun: the things that decide whether heat is dangerous. Killeen's climate (on the Central Texas plains near Fort Cavazos, Killeen endures long, sun-drenched summers where humid triple-digit heat drives up heat-exposure risk.) is exactly why a single "feels-like" or thermometer reading can understate the real risk. WBGT captures all of it in one number.
When is heat most dangerous in Killeen?
Heat stress peaks in the early-to-mid afternoon, when sun load is highest. Use the forecast on this page to find the coolest window.
